Golf Cart Use in Island Lake South

As part of a five-year pilot program initiated by the Alberta government, the Summer Village of Island Lake South has enacted Bylaw 129-25, permitting the use of golf carts on public roads within the village.​

Key Guidelines for Golf Cart Operation:
  • Permitted Areas: Golf carts are allowed on all public roads within Island Lake South.​
  • Operator Requirements: Operators must be at least 14 years old.​
  • Seating Capacity: The number of passengers must not exceed the number of seats in the golf cart.​
  • Safety Measures: All passengers should remain seated while the cart is in motion.​
  • Compliance: Operators must adhere to all applicable traffic laws and regulations.​
Obtaining a Golf Cart Permit:

To legally operate a golf cart on public roads in Island Lake South, residents must obtain a permit by submitting the required application and applicable fees.​

Application Process:

  • Download the Application Form: Access the Golf Cart Permit Application form from the official Island Lake South website.​
  • Complete the Form: Fill out all required fields accurately.​
  • Submit the Application: Follow the submission instructions provided on the form.​
  • Submit the Application Fee: E-transfer $25/application to svislandlakesouth@outlook.com
